Situated in a prime Santa Barbara location on the sea front, Ala Mar features guest room suites overlooking the harbor. This is a comfortable, beachy and casual place to stay.

Worst night's sleep ever!

The rooms lack privacy. The "ocean view" windows all face guest walkways, so you must keep shutters closed for any privacy. No air conditioner in very stuffy room, but you need to keep windows closed due to noise and traffic all night. Worse yet, there was a fake thermostat on the wall. Thin walls and ceilings added to the noise problem. Poor service from a smart-alec kid at front desk. For instance, I asked for soap (which they don't provide), and he said "I'll add it to my list." Way over-priced. I wouldn't stay there again for free.

over priced and under maintained

I rented 2 rooms, on for my girlfriend and I and one for her mom. Our room had a closet nailed shut and a coat rack attached to the door. Her mom's room reeked of cigarette smoke even though it's a non-smoking hotel. Her window crank was broken, and neither wall heater was operating. The desk clerk spent about 20 minutes trying to get one started, but then it wouldn't shut off. We both had to use portable heaters. Each room had thin floors/ceilings and the sound from upstairs poured through.

No Value For Your Money!!

Upon check in we were given a room that can only be described as a dark, dingy slum. The comforter and matching shams were filthy; the pillows old and filthy; for two people there were 2 threadbare towels with large yellow stains and one threadbare, stained wash cloth. The broken light fixtures were straight out of the discard bin from Goodwill. We asked for another room and were given a key to a similar room, with a bigger bed. The clerk then gave us another key for a 2nd floor room. This room was nice, updated, bright & clean. Same threadbare towels, however. For the money, there are better, cleaner places with pools.
